.side-header-narrow-bar-logo{max-width:170px}.page-top ul.breadcrumb>li.home{display:inline-block}.page-top ul.breadcrumb>li.home a{position:relative;width:1em;text-indent:-9999px}.page-top ul.breadcrumb>li.home a:after{content:"";font-family:"porto";float:left;text-indent:0}.custom-font4{font-family:"Segoe Script","Savoye LET"}.shortcode_wysija{display:table;width:100%;max-width:460px;margin-left:auto;margin-right:auto}.shortcode_wysija .wysija-paragraph{display:table-cell;border:none;vertical-align:middle}.shortcode_wysija .wysija-input{border:none;height:3.25rem;padding-left:20px;padding-right:20px}.shortcode_wysija .wysija-submit{height:3.25rem;padding:10px 2rem;text-shadow:none!important;font-size:.75rem}.porto_products_filter_form .btn-submit{display:none}.porto_products_filter_form select{height:2.8125rem;margin-bottom:.625rem}.porto_products_filter_form select+select{margin-bottom:0}.coupon-sale-text{padding:6px 8px;position:relative;transform:rotate(-1.5deg)}.coupon-sale-text i{font-style:normal;position:absolute;left:-2.25em;top:50%;transform:translateY(-50%) rotate(-90deg);font-size:.4em;opacity:.6;letter-spacing:0}.coupon-sale-text sub{position:absolute;left:100%;margin-left:.25rem;bottom:.3em;font-size:70%;line-height:1}.coupon-sale-text.heading-light i,.coupon-sale-text.heading-light sub{color:#222529}sup{font-size:54%}.off-text{margin-left:-.345em}.off-text small{display:inline-block!important;font-size:39%!important;font-weight:inherit;transform:rotate(-90deg) translate(25%,-35%)}.text-color-primary h5{color:inherit}ul.products li.product-category .thumb-info-title{width:auto;background:#282828;padding:.9em 1.4em}ul.products li.product-category .thumb-info h3{letter-spacing:-.035em;font-size:.875rem}.section-product-light .product-image img{filter:brightness(1.06)}.off-text{margin-left:-.3825em}.link-decoration-none a{text-decoration:none}.porto-ibanner .brand-logo{transform:rotate(-90deg) translateY(-50%);transform-origin:100% 0;max-width:105px}.banner-content-right>.porto-ibanner-layer>.elementor-widget-wrap{display:flex;display:-ms-flexbox;flex-direction:column;-ms-flex-direction:column;align-items:flex-end;-ms-flex-align:end}.custom-font4 h3{font-family:inherit}.elementor-widget-heading.heading-border{display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center}.elementor-widget-heading.heading-border:before,.elementor-widget-heading.heading-border:after{content:"";-ms-flex:1;flex:1;border-top:1px solid #dcdedf}.elementor-widget-heading.heading-border:before{margin-right:8px}.elementor-widget-heading.heading-border:after{margin-left:8px}.brand-slider img{max-width:130px}.custom-font4 .elementor-heading-title{font-family:"Segoe Script","Savoye LET"}.porto-ibanner-layer .btn-modern.btn-lg{padding:1.05em 3em;font-size:.9375em}.text-sale .elementor-heading-title{white-space:nowrap;line-height:.95!important}.text-sale small{display:inline-block!important;font-size:27%!important;word-break:break-all;width:1em;text-align:center;font-weight:inherit;white-space:normal}.section-width-sidebar .widget .widget-title{font-size:14px;color:#fff;background:#e9846b;padding:14px 0 14px 20px;line-height:22px;text-transform:none;margin-bottom:0}.section-width-sidebar .widget .widget-title:before{content:"";font-family:"Font Awesome 5 Free";margin-right:10px;font-weight:900;position:relative;top:-1px}.section-width-sidebar .widget_product_categories .toggle{display:none}.section-width-sidebar .widget_product_categories>ul{border:1px solid #e7e7e7;border-top:none;padding:0}.section-width-sidebar .widget_product_categories>ul li{padding:14px 0;margin:0 20px;border-top:1px solid #e7e7e7}.section-width-sidebar .widget_product_categories>ul li:first-child{border-top:none}.section-width-sidebar .widget_product_categories>ul li a{font-size:14px;font-weight:600;color:#222529;padding:0;text-decoration:none!important}.section-width-sidebar .top-icon .porto-sicon-header{margin-bottom:.1rem}.newsletter-form .widget_wysija .wysija-input{height:3.25rem;font-size:.875rem;box-shadow:none;padding-left:1.25rem;border:none}.newsletter-form .widget_wysija .wysija-submit{padding:0 2.5rem;height:3.25rem;font-size:.875rem}.newsletter-form .widget_wysija .wysija-paragraph{margin-bottom:0}.text-price .elementor-heading-title{line-height:.98}.text-price b{font-size:200%;vertical-align:text-top}.top-bar{overflow:hidden}.top-bar .porto-carousel{margin-right:-2px;width:calc(100% + 2px)}.top-bar .porto-sicon-box{margin-bottom:12px;justify-content:center}.top-bar .porto-sicon-default .porto-icon{margin-right:.5rem}.top-bar>div:not(:last-child) .porto-sicon-box{border-right:1px solid #e7e7e7}.brand-slider img{width:auto!important;margin-left:auto;margin-right:auto}@media (max-width:360px){.porto-ibanner-layer{font-size:10px}}@media (max-width:767px){.home-banner .porto-ibanner-layer{font-size:4vw}}